The Health and Social Care Diploma is designed for individuals seeking a career in the healthcare sector, focusing on the principles and practices of health and social care.
Level 2: Building Foundations in Health and Social Care introduces the fundamental concepts of health and wellbeing, care planning, and communication skills.
Level 3: Developing Skills in Health and Social Care builds upon the foundation, exploring topics such as health promotion, disease prevention, and supporting individuals with diverse needs.
Level 4: Advanced Practice in Health and Social Care delves into specialized areas like mental health, learning disabilities, and end-of-life care, preparing learners for leadership roles.
Level 5: Specialist Practice in Health and Social Care focuses on advanced clinical skills, policy development, and strategic leadership, equipping learners to drive positive change.
Level 6: Expert Practice in Health and Social Care is designed for experienced professionals seeking to enhance their expertise, with a focus on research-informed practice, innovation, and policy implementation.
